Wellness real estate and technology firm Delos has announced the latest in a long line of strategic alliances as it continues its bid to expand the global reach of the WELL Building Standard in the architecture and design sector.

The latest partnership is with full-service consulting and engineering firm Glumac. The deal will leverage the latter’s extensive network of sustainably-minded clients, encouraging them to pursue the healthy building standard for their developments.

Glumac has already positioned itself as a leader in the healthy building movement, with nine of its projects registered to pursue WELL Certification.

Now it will become a member of the Well Living Lab – a collaboration between Delos and Mayo Clinic and the world’s first human-centred research lab dedicated to understanding the relationship between the built environment and human health and wellness.

The company will also ensure its own offices meet WELL standards; advise on how to roll out the WELL Building Standard efficiently; and train 20 of its employees through the WELL Accredited Professional programme, which signifies an “advanced knowledge in human health and wellness in the built environment.”

“Glumac looks forward to collaborating with Delos to provide the healthiest indoor environments possible,” said Steve Straus, CEO and president of Glumac. “Our work in MEP engineering, energy modelling, and building commissioning has a direct effect on the health, well-being, and productivity of the people who live and work in the projects we design. Setting an international standard will allow our clients to know they have best in class spaces.”

The company’s chief sustainability strategist, Nicole Isle, added: “It’s critical that clean air, water, abundant natural daylight and connections with the outdoor world are integrated into indoor spaces, given the impact on our general health and productivity. Evidence emerging from this partnership will help the industry understand that when designed well, the benefits of green building technologies to human health and return on investment go hand in hand.”

A number of leisure projects have been delivered by Glumac in the US, including Bonita Unified School District Center for the Performing Arts in San Dimas, Allison Inn & Spa in Newberg, the Levi's Stadium in Santa Clara, and Indian Wells Tennis Garden.
